干这行七年了,真的受够了那种“大概”、“随便”、“看着办”的甲方。
上周有个客户找我,说要做个企业官网。我问他具体要啥功能。他回了一句:“就跟某某网站差不多,但我们要更大气一点。”
我差点把刚喝进去的茶喷出来。
“差不多”是啥意思?“大气”怎么量化?这种需求要是写进合同里,最后扯皮能扯到明年去。
今天我就掏心窝子跟大家聊聊,为什么一份靠谱的网站开发项目需求文档能救你的命,也能救开发者的命。
很多人觉得写文档麻烦,想直接让程序员干活。
大错特错。
你不说清楚,人家怎么给你做?最后做出来的东西不是你想要的,你还怪人家技术不行。这锅背得冤不冤?
我见过太多这样的案例。有个做餐饮的朋友,非要搞个在线点餐系统。他没写文档,就口头说了句“要有个菜单”。
结果开发出来,菜单是静态图片,用户点不了,还得打电话订餐。
这叫什么?这叫无效开发。
浪费的是真金白银啊。
所以,听我一句劝,不管项目大小,先把网站开发项目需求文档搞出来。
怎么搞?别被那些专业术语吓到,咱们用大白话来说。
第一步,搞清楚你是谁,你要卖给谁。
别整那些虚头巴脑的品牌故事,就写清楚:你的目标客户是年轻人还是老年人?他们习惯用手机看还是电脑看?
比如我做的那个跨境电商项目,用户全是老外,那加载速度必须快,图片必须压缩到极致,否则人家等两秒就跑了。
这就是需求,得写进文档里。
第二步,列出功能清单,越细越好。
别只写“有购物车”。
要写:购物车支持修改数量吗?支持删除吗?支持合并订单吗?
还有支付环节,支持支付宝、微信,还是只支持信用卡?
如果用户支付失败,页面跳哪里?有没有错误提示?
这些细节,全在网站开发项目需求文档里体现。
我有个同行,之前因为没写清楚“后台权限管理”,结果老板能看所有数据,普通员工连登录密码都改不了,最后客户投诉说系统太烂,差点退钱。
这就是教训。
第三步,确定设计风格,给参考图。
别光说“高端大气上档次”。
你直接找三个你觉得好看的网站,发给开发说:“我要这种感觉,但颜色换成蓝色。”
这就叫可视化需求。
文字描述是苍白的,图片才是王道。
第四步,明确时间节点和预算。
什么时候上线?有没有促销活动要配合?
预算多少?别想着用五百块做出五百万的效果,那是不可能的。
把预期管理好,双方都舒服。
最后,我要吐槽一点。
很多老板觉得写文档是浪费时间,其实那是他们在省小钱花大钱。
前期多花两天时间梳理需求,后期能省两个月返工的时间。
这笔账,谁算谁明白。
现在市面上有些团队,拿着模板随便填填就敢报价,这种千万别信。
你要找的是那种愿意跟你一起抠细节,愿意把网站开发项目需求文档写得密密麻麻的团队。
因为他们是在对你负责,也是在对他们自己的口碑负责。
如果你正头疼怎么写这份文档,或者不知道自己的需求是否合理,欢迎随时来找我聊聊。
我不一定接你的单,但我可以帮你看看你的需求有没有坑。
毕竟,这行水太深,我不想看大家再踩同样的坑了。
记住,好的开始是成功的一半,而好的需求文档,就是那个好的开始。
别犹豫,赶紧动笔吧。